Applied online. Received an email to schedule for the phone interviews. Had two phone interviews and one onsite interview. I am still waiting to hear from the company. The interview primarily consisted of questions related to recursion/dynamic programming/data structures. Each problem was asked to be coded in the white board. Knowledge of Unix/Perl was a plus.
It started with an OA, and then after a few weeks, I got invited to four rounds of interviews: technical and behavioral at 3 of the 4, and behavioral only at one.

The whole process stretched over nearly a month, longer than I anticipated. After an initial phone screen, I faced a technical round that included a Min Stack implementation question. We discussed design considerations and thread safety, which threw me for a bit. Fortunately, I remembered a specific mock interview I practiced on PracHub that mirrored this scenario closely, making me feel more at ease. Ultimately, I received an offer, but I chose to decline due to the company culture not feeling like the right fit.
